Lauren Silverman Backs Bid to Raise UK Social Media Age to 16 Ahead of Commons Vote

Bereaved families cite addictive app design as grounds for a legal curb.

Overview

  • Silverman has joined the Raise the Age campaign pushing a UK law to bar under‑16s from social media, with a House of Commons vote scheduled this week.
  • Her stance hardened after she found her 12‑year‑old had installed Snapchat on her phone, so she banned social apps and now allows only texting and WhatsApp.
  • She says she monitors his group chats to track what classmates share and to spot problems early.
  • She highlights bereaved parents like Ellen Roome, who links her 14‑year‑old’s 2022 death to an online challenge and is seeking TikTok data.
  • Campaigners cite Australia’s December law and recent U.S. rulings against Meta and YouTube as evidence that stricter rules and platform accountability can reduce harm.
